While planning your visit to Langbank Train Station, it's important to note that the station is somewhat basic in its offerings. There is no ticket office or ticket machines available, so travelers should be prepared with tickets bought in advance. Fortunately, smartcard validators are in place for those using smartcards, allowing for a seamless journey without needing a paper ticket. For passengers requiring assistance, help points are available, but there's no staff assistance directly at the station. Services such as departure screens and announcements keep passengers informed about their journeys. Despite its simplicity, Langbank Train Station provides step-free access in parts of the station with ramps leading to both platforms. Travelers should be aware that step distances might vary more than usual when boarding or alighting trains here.

Gomshall Train Station is cherished for its simplistic charm, but travelers should plan ahead to accommodate the limited facilities. There is no ticket office or machines available at the station, so it's essential to purchase your tickets in advance online. If you need assistance during your travel, a helpful customer support point can be found on-site. Also, for those with mobility considerations, Gomshall provides step-free access and a dedicated pick-up/drop-off point adjacent to platform 1. However, other amenities such as wa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shment facilities are not available on site.
